Parser-level budgets rather than post-parse checks. Codex's architectural point
was that inspecting after parsing is too late because the allocation already
happened, so Limits and Budget enforce byte size, depth, node count, registered
objects, symbol definitions, collection entries, scalar bytes and object links
DURING recursive descent. The size ceiling is checked before the parser is
constructed and non-String input is rejected without ever calling to_s.

Three policies, STRICT_ALLOWLIST as the default, on the reasoning that people
keep defaults far longer than they intend. No enforcing mode accepts an
allowed_sinks option, because permitting a class-and-sink pair still authorizes
a callback during load. OBSERVE_AND_LOG refuses to construct without a
reporter. Allowlisting a class does NOT exempt its sinks, and that is a test.

No method is named safe?, trusted?, sanitized? or safe_load, and a test asserts
their absence. Those names claim a guarantee this cannot make.

The gate demonstrates the documented bypass rather than asserting it. Under
DENY_SINKS_ONLY the detector ACCEPTS the CVE-2026-41316 payload, and the gate
then loads that accepted snapshot on vulnerable erb and confirms the canary
fires. Our own detector, in a shipped mode, admits a payload that achieves code
execution. That is the limitation notice being true rather than decorative, and
if it ever stops being demonstrable the gate fails.

The notice ships verbatim and names the bypass concretely: a payload carrying
no sink tag can still reach dangerous code, the published chain produces zero
sink tags because ERB defines no marshal_load, and an application that
allowlists ERB will accept it.

LIMITATION_NOTICE = <<~NOTICE.freeze
SECURITY LIMITATION
Rube::Marshal::BoundaryDetector examines a bounded snapshot of Marshal bytes and
applies a caller-selected policy before deserialization. An ACCEPT decision means
only that this snapshot matched that policy.
Acceptance does not make the payload safe, trusted, authenticated, or free of
gadget behavior. This detector does not sandbox Ruby, audit the current
implementations of allowlisted classes, freeze the runtime class graph, or prevent
callbacks and implicit method dispatch that its parser or policy fails to model.
Class allowlisting compares serialized names. It does not prove that the
corresponding Ruby code is harmless.
A payload carrying no sink tag can still reach dangerous code. The published
CVE-2026-41316 chain produces zero sink tags because ERB defines no marshal_load.
It is caught by class allowlisting alone, and an application that allowlists ERB
will accept it.
NOTICE
